What degree did you pursue and why?  

Master of Business Administration. I chose to pursue this degree to expand on skills in the business industry and become a more desirable candidate for future career opportunities.

Why did you choose the Belk College of Business over others?

The course schedule was very flexible and accommodating for full-time employees. The location of the uptown campus is perfect for working adults since most do not work near the main campus. Overall the quality of the program and business school at UNC Charlotte was a great fit.

Tell us about your job. What lessons have you learned in your courses that you were able to apply to the job?

I am currently an associate buyer at Belk department store in the cosmetics division.  My team and I work very closely with the digital and print marketing departments to secure multi-channel exposure for our key sales-driving strategies.  The marketing electives that correlated with my concentration were helpful to gain more insight into what tactics have worked best for other companies. This has helped me develop more effective marketing campaigns at work based on top trends throughout the industry.

What has been the best part of your academic experience? 

The study abroad program that is in between the fall and spring semesters was amazing!  I was able to attend the trip that went to Lyon, France earlier this year. It’s a great selling point that the university offers study abroad opportunities in graduate school. This trip was such a memorable experience for me and would definitely recommend it to other students in the program.

Another one of my favorite parts of the academic experience was meeting and networking with my fellow classmates.  It is really nice to relate with other working adults outside of your own company or social group. I also really enjoyed hearing other’s experiences expressed during in-class discussions and group projects.

How would you describe the Belk College of Business to someone considering a master’s program?

The Belk College of Business is a great program for working adults that are looking to grow in their careers.  The professors really bring their on the job experiences into the classroom to make the courses more valuable in the industry.  

How valuable do you feel this degree will be to your career?

The education I have received during the program has been very easily relatable to situations that I have experienced at work.  I hope that my degree will help to open up doors for potential career opportunities that arise in the future.
